BRNO (Czech Republic): Johann Zarco claimed pole for this weekend’s Czech MotoGP on Saturday three hundredths of a second ahead of championship leader Fabio Quartararo.
The Ducati-Avintia rider pipped his French compatriot who won the opening two rounds of the coronavirus-curtailed season from pole for Yamaha‘s satellite SRT team.
World champion Marc Marquez continues to be absent as he recovers from another bout of surgery on the arm he broke in a first race crash of the campaign.
Zarco, 30, who left KTM in the middle of last season due to poor results, was claiming his sixth MotoGP pole.
